OK, so the last thread fizzled out and was an early planning thread. It's time to get serious now.

CLICK HERE TO FIND OUT ABOUT JAE

Tickets as per the site are £45 each. If you want to be on the Club Stand, the cost will be £50 each. The extra £5 goes towards the cost of the actual plot. This year the price is the same regardless of whether you join on the Thursday or the Friday.

Day tickets are available directly from the JAE website, but having a day ticket means you won't get your Elgrand on the stand.

We need to have at least 28 Elgrand's on the stand.

Caravans are allowed and will be parked on the club stand, so space is limited. The plot will be split between the vehicles, the living area, and the camping area. I'll do a layout design as we get closer to the event and we know how many people are coming.

To keep it simple, JAE is a massive car show with thousands of Japanese cars on show from hundreds of clubs. The event is huge with plenty to do for all the family. Dogs are allowed but must be kept on a lead and poo must be picked up. Same goes for kids (rofl). Please note there is a firework display on Saturday night, so dogs and children that might find this distressing might want to be taken out for the evening (the site is free to come and go as long as you have a wrist band.

JAE is a chance for us all to get together, relax, have a few drinks and enjoy good food with good company. There will be a marquee, seats, a BBQ, music, and everything you need to enjoy a long weekend away.

Please support the club, the show and the Japanese car scene by coming along.

There are NO restrictions on who attends. To come to the show you just need a Japanese car. To be on the ElgrandOC stand, you need an Elgrand. It doesn't need to be "show car" quality. It doesn't need to be fancy. It doesn't need to be modified. It doesn't need to be "as new". Being clean is preferred, and if it's not, I'll probably clean it for you when it's on the stand.

I am going to need payment for tickets ASAP so that I know who is definitely coming. I am unsure of the deadline to buy tickets yet, but I will find out and add it to this thread when I know.

Children under 12 are free (2 per each paying adult). Each adult ticket is £50. Payment needs to go to karl@elgrandoc.uk. Please include your username in the payment details so I know who each payment relates to.
